Producer jobs in Forsyth, North Carolina involve overseeing various aspects of production, such as budgeting, scheduling, and coordinating resources. Responsibilities may include collaborating with directors and talent, managing production crews, and ensuring projects are completed on time and within budget.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region
Producer in Forsyth, North Carolina play a crucial role in overseeing the creation and development of various forms of media content. - Entry-level Production Assistant salaries range from $25,000 to $35,000 per year - Mid-career Producer salaries range from $45,000 to $60,000 per year - Senior-level Executive Producer salaries range from $70,000 to $100,000 per year The history of production in Forsyth, North Carolina can be traced back to the early days of the film and television industry when the region became a popular filming location for various projects. As production techniques and technology advanced, the role of producers evolved to encompass not only traditional media but also digital content creation and distribution. Current trends in production in Forsyth, North Carolina include a shift towards interactive and immersive media experiences, increased collaboration with international partners, and a growing emphasis on sustainability practices in production processes.
